Trends and Prospects for the Development of Virtual Reality and Digital Property

The study considers trends and prospects for developing virtual (augmented) reality and civil transactions in relation to digital property. In jurisprudence, there is a need to determine the legal status of virtual and augmented reality to regulate legal relations in the digital environment. Legal relations using new digital technologies require the creation of new legislative approaches and rules of their legal regulation. The article dwells on the legal status of virtual (augmented) reality and determines the methods of regulating legal relations in the sphere of digital property. The study utilized methods for collecting single and multiple facts in order to identify the main trends in the civil circulation of digital assets, as well as private law methods. The methods of generalization, concreteness, induction and deduction reveal the legal nature and main features of virtual (augmented) reality and digital property. The paper highlights the specifics of virtual reality and civil transactions in relation to digital assets. The research has concluded that the sale, exchange and other actions with digital objects in virtual reality have distinctive features, while digital property has also unique characteristics since it is involved in civil circulation and legal relations.
Source Forensics of Black Carbon Aerosols from China

<P>The limited understanding of black carbon (BC) aerosol emissions from incomplete combustion causes a poorly constrained anthropogenic climate warming that globally may be second only to CO<SUB>2</SUB> and regionally, such as over East Asia, the dominant driver of climate change. The relative contribution to atmospheric BC from fossil fuel versus biomass combustion is important to constrain as fossil BC is a stronger climate forcer. The source apportionment is the underpinning for targeted mitigation actions. However, technology-based “bottom-up” emission inventories are inconclusive, largely due to uncertain BC emission factors from small-scale/household combustion and open burning. We use “top-down” radiocarbon measurements of atmospheric BC from five sites including three city sites and two regional sites to determine that fossil fuel combustion produces 80 ± 6% of the BC emitted from China. This source-diagnostic radiocarbon signal in the ambient aerosol over East Asia establishes a much larger role for fossil fuel combustion than suggested by all 15 BC emission inventory models, including one with monthly resolution. Our results suggest that current climate modeling should refine both BC emission strength and consider the stronger radiative absorption associated with fossil-fuel-derived BC. DESTINATION NEUROGENETICS:CREATION OF DESTINATION MEME MAPS OF TOURISTS

Even though Memetics, the study area of meme maps, has been well-studied in the Cognitive Neuroscience and Computer Science disciplines, there has been no research attempt on Memetics in the Tourism and Hospitality field. Seminal studies in the marketing field suggest that the concepts of destination image and meme maps are highly-related. Accordingly, the purpose of the current study is twofold: (1) to identify the overall Destination Image Meme Maps of Antalya, Turkey and their favorite tourism destination, and (2) to identify and evaluate the similarities and differences in the structures of the previously generated two categories of Destination Image Meme Maps. The data was gathered from two samples consisting of 272 Russian and 262 German travelers visiting a medium-sized city (i.e. Antalya) located in the south region of Turkey. This study adopts and enhances the knowledge of Memetics into Tourism and Hospitality research. It also provides important practical and methodological contributions.
